Coeliac · Gluten-free

confidence 0.60 ·

Available on request, No marked menu but staff will accommodate. Quality varies by who is working that shift.

GF pizza bases are available as a menu add-on (+$5), reportedly made fresh each morning. No per-dish GF codes appear across the wider menu — the GF note is a section-level add-on in the pizza category, not individual dish marking. The website instructs guests to make staff aware of allergens. No dedicated fryer or prep area is evidenced. No GF desserts. One community reviewer noted that ordering GF was 'tricky'. Not a dedicated or certified GF facility.

Vegan

confidence 0.45 ·

Available on request, No marked menu but staff will accommodate. Quality varies by who is working that shift.

The Garden pizza lists 'Add Vegan Cheese $5' as an option, indicating at least one vegan-adaptable dish. No VG marking elsewhere on the menu. Evidence is too thin to confirm broader systematic vegan accommodation.
